Abstract :
Two series of chiral organometallic Donor-π-Acceptor chromophores derived from [Fe2(η5-C5H5)2(CO)2(μ-CO)(μ-CCH3)]+ [BF4]− have been synthesised. In the first series (S)-(−)-2-methoxymethyl pyrrolidine acts as the chiral donor end group and in the second series 1,1′-binaphthyl acts as the chiral π-bridging unit. The nonlinear optical properties of these compounds were measured by the Kurtz powder technique and by hyper-Raleigh scattering. β-values of up to 964×10−30 esu were obtained for a member of the first series. Single crystal X-ray studies of [Fe2(η5-C5H5)2(CO)2(μ-CO)(μ-CCH3)]+ [BF4]−, [Fe2(η5-C5H4CH3)2(CO)2(μ-CO)(μ-(E)-CCHCH-2-(5-piperidin-1-yl-thiophene))]+ [BF4]− and [Fe2(η5-C5H4CH3)2(CO)2(μ-CO)(μ-(E)-CCHCH-2-(naphthalene))]+ [BF4]− are reported.
